Hi
Great, those issues look like they're fixed. Here's a v3 update;
- Wording tweaked.
- Link to Font Awesome added.
- HTML reformatted (mostly by Pycharm)
- </br> changed to <br/>
- s/ria-controls/aria-controls/g
There are a couple of things left I found that could do with some work:
- On the iconography section, the anchor tags to the sub-sections only work for the standard theme. should we split each set of icons out into separate pages (like the controls) rather than trying to have long pages with anchors?
- The page names used in the view/templates and URLs is quite ugly. Could we change the names, and then use URL matching rather than GET parameters? e.g.
/styleguide/?tab=typg -> /styleguide/typography
/styleguide/?tab=thm§ion=alrt -> /styleguide/themes/alerts
/styleguide/?tab=ic#custom_query_plan -> /styleguide/iconography/query_plans (assuming we split the icon pages)
Thanks!
